You might be right that the remaining ones that slip through your regex are mere "nuisance"s. But you know how those things go - one man's nuisance is another man's vuln. Some of those, anyhow, are implemented by the Linux console driver.

Why not just take the tried and true "safe" route, as implemented by vis(3)'s VIS_SAFE or similar? Otherwise it sounds like you're playing with a bit of fire.

Put differently, is there some legitimate use case of the ANSI escape characters that make you want to preserve some of their usage while disallowing other parts? If so, that would really surprise me.
